Save Your Skin From The Summer Sun

Want to look younger? Stay out of the sun this summer! Sun damage is the #1 cause of wrinkles. Want to prevent the sun from damaging your skin? Try these tips:

1 Always apply sunscreen before heading outdoors. – even on cloudy days. Use at least a SPF 30 sun block for the best protection, and reapply often. Most brands are only active for about an hour.

2 Avoid exposure during peak hours. Stay indoors when the sun is strongest — between 10 am and 4 pm. If you must be outside during these peak hours, take precautions. Seek shade, wear a hat, and sunglasses.

3 Know how your medications are affected by the sun. Some antibiotics and allergy medicines can make you more sensitive to sun exposure.

Being careful to avoid prolonged outings in the sun will help limit the damage to your skin, but also knowing how to use sunscreen the right way can also help. First, remember, that sunscreen is used to actually absorb the sun’s rays before they can damage your skin, but they are foolproof, so don’t rely on sunscreen alone to protect your skin.

Here are some additional tips when using sunscreen:
4 Pick a higher SPF number. A 30 will protect you against 96% of the sun’s harmful rays.

5 Put in on at least 30 minutes before heading outdoors, and use plenty. Most people only use a fraction of the recommended dosage. Read and follow labels carefully.

6 Remember, waterproof sunscreens don’t last all day. Reapply after 90 minutes.
